TikTok, the ubiquitous short-form video platform, has captivated the global audience with its addictive content and meteoric rise. Understanding the genesis of TikTok delves into the intertwined motivations, technological advancements, and cultural shifts that culminated in its creation.

The Founding Vision: A Stage for Creative Expression

TikTok’s inception can be traced back to 2016 when Zhang Yimin, the founder of the Chinese tech giant ByteDance, recognized a growing demand for mobile-first, user-generated content. Driven by a desire to empower individuals to express themselves creatively, ByteDance launched Douyin, the Chinese version of TikTok, in September 2016.

The Power of Artificial Intelligence

Artificial intelligence (AI) plays a pivotal role in TikTok’s functionality. Its advanced algorithms analyze user preferences, curate personalized content recommendations, and facilitate seamless video creation. By leveraging AI, TikTok democratizes content creation, making it accessible to users of all skill levels.

The Rise of Short-Form Video

The popularity of short-form video content, particularly among younger generations, significantly influenced TikTok‘s development. The platform’s focus on bite-sized, engaging videos aligns with the evolving attention spans and mobile consumption habits of today’s digital natives.

Capturing the Youthful Audience

TikTok’s target audience is predominantly Gen Z and Millennials. The platform’s playful, lighthearted atmosphere, coupled with its emphasis on popular music and youth culture, has resonated strongly with this demographic. TikTok has become a hub for self-expression, entertainment, and connection for young people worldwide.

Global Expansion and Cultural Impact

TikTok’s success in China paved the way for its global expansion. In 2017, the platform was rebranded as TikTok and introduced to international markets. Its rapid adoption across cultures highlights its universal appeal and the growing global demand for creative and authentic content.

The Entertainment Revolution

TikTok has transformed the entertainment landscape. Its endless stream of short videos provides a constant source of amusement and distraction. The platform has also fostered a new generation of content creators, who have leveraged TikTok’s reach to showcase their talents and build loyal followings.

The Business Opportunity

TikTok’s immense popularity has not gone unnoticed by businesses. The platform offers a unique opportunity for brands to engage with a vast and highly engaged audience. TikTok’s advertising options and influencer marketing capabilities have made it a valuable tool for reaching target consumers and boosting brand awareness.
